How You Should Handle Pennsylvania Solar Panel Installation Evaluations

Pennsylvania Solar Panel Installation Companies compare primarily through their adherence to strict safety and legal standards, which protect you from financial liability and guarantee high-quality workmanship. A valid solar company must maintain active electrical and general contractor credentials, as these demonstrate that the business has satisfied the specific technical and regulatory standards mandated by state and local authorities to execute electrical work on your property.

“Look for solar businesses that have several years of experience, maintain certification by the National American Board of Certified Energy Practitioners (NABCEP), have a good reputation in the community (and list many of their projects on their websites), have adequate workmen's compensation and liability insurances.” — pasolarcenter.org

Beyond basic licensing, you must confirm that an installer possesses robust insurance coverage to mitigate the risks inherent in rooftop construction. When you examine different firms, prioritize those that provide transparent documentation regarding their operational safety protocols. The subsequent table outlines the necessary documentation you should ask for during your initial consultation to verify a company's legitimacy:

Document Type Purpose
State/Local Contractor License Verifies legal authorization to operate in your jurisdiction.
General Liability Insurance Guards your home from damage during the installation process.
Workers' Compensation Insurance Prevents you from being liable for injuries incurred by crew personnel.
Electrical Permit Records Verifies the installer adheres to local building and safety codes.

Validating these credentials is a crucial step in your due diligence routine. If an installer cannot provide proof of current insurance or valid licensing, you should look elsewhere, as the risk of property damage or unpermitted work far exceeds any potential savings. Always call the granting authority listed on the provided license documents to confirm that they are active and in good standing before executing a contract.

How You Should Approach Your 85–100% Annual Usage Offset Target

An 85–100% annual usage offset target is the calculated goal for designing a system to replace the vast majority of your annual electricity usage using solar power. When you begin searching for and Finding reputable solar panel installation companies in Pennsylvania, they will first examine your last twelve months of utility statements to establish your baseline energy demand. This data is then verified with local peak sun hours to ensure the proposed array can produce enough kilowatt-hours to meet your particular household needs.

“Where net metering is one-for-one at retail — Pennsylvania, New Jersey, Virginia, Maine — sizing to 100% of annual usage is defensible, because an exported kilowatt-hour and a consumed one are worth the same.” — solaramerica.io

Numerous technical limitations affect the ultimate capacity of your solar panel installation:

  • Available Roof Surface: The total square footage of unshaded, south-facing roof area limits the number of panels you can actually mount.
  • Utility Buyback Policies: Rules often cap the maximum system size allowed based on your historical annual usage, preventing oversized arrays that send excessive power to the grid.
  • Energy Efficiency: Reducing your base load through home improvements can enable for a smaller, more cost-effective system to reach your offset target.

If you are planning your installation, use the following table to comprehend how consumption data determines sizing requirements:

Annual Usage (kWh) Typical System Size (kW) Estimated Offset
8,000 5.0 ~85%
15,000 9.5 ~95%
20,000 12.87 ~100%

Ask for a detailed production estimate from your solar company that considers your specific roof orientation and local shading factors before determining your system capacity.

How You Can Handle The $7,000–$18,000 Battery Storage Add-On Expense For Your Solar Panel Installation

A $7,000–$18,000 battery storage add-on cost represents the financial outlay required to integrate energy storage hardware into your Pennsylvania solar panel installation. This investment operates by storing excess electricity generated during solar hours, allowing you to utilize that power during the evening or to keep essential circuits when the grid experiences an outage. When evaluating Pennsylvania-based solar panel installation companies to consider, you should recognize that the particular price within this range depends significantly on the storage capacity and the chemical composition of the battery units chosen for your home.

The decision to integrate a home battery involves balancing precise performance compromises against your household energy goals:

Feature Standard Solar Only Solar with Battery Storage
Grid Independence Minimal High (during outages)
Evening Usage Purchased from grid Stored solar energy
Project Complexity Lower Higher

Beyond the upfront financial impact, you must also weigh the physical requirements of a battery system, including the need for a climate-controlled installation space and specialized electrical integration. Not every solar installer provides the same array of battery technologies, so it is vital to verify that your chosen provider has documented experience with the particular chemistry, such as lithium iron phosphate, that perfectly suits your anticipated discharge cycles. Confirm whether your preferred battery unit enables whole-home backup or is limited to a sub-panel of critical loads before finalizing your equipment list.

The performance of your hardware relies on the geometry of your roof and the presence of external obstructions that block light. In the local climate, a south-facing roof surface provides the most consistent energy production, though east and west orientations remain feasible choices for many homeowners.

“The height of the system shall be less than 18 inches above the adjacent roof.” — phila.gov

To ascertain if your home is a candidate for a high-performance system, consider these critical location factors:

  • Orientation: A true south-facing roof collects the most consistent daily solar energy.
  • Pitch: A roof slope between 15 and 40 degrees optimizes the angle of incidence for sunlight.
  • Shading: Nearby trees, chimneys, or neighboring structures create shadows that significantly reduce total annual output.
  • Structural Integrity: Your roof must be in sound condition, as the structural load capacity must support the weight of the hardware and withstand local weather stresses.

Beyond these variables, you should evaluate the age of your roofing material. Because a solar system installation is engineered to last for decades, installing modules on a roof that needs replacement in the near future will lead to unnecessary removal and reinstallation costs. Confirm the remaining lifespan of your shingles or metal roofing before completing your project design.
